CVE-2022-32797 is a high-severity vulnerability rated 7.1/10 on the CVSS scale. This issue was addressed with improved checks. This issue is fixed in Security Update 2022-005 Catalina, macOS Big Sur 11.6.8, macOS Monterey 12.5. EPSS estimates a 0.99%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
Description
This issue was addressed with improved checks. This issue is fixed in Security Update 2022-005 Catalina, macOS Big Sur 11.6.8, macOS Monterey 12.5. Processing a maliciously crafted AppleScript binary may result in unexpected termination or disclosure of process memory.
